Looking at the concept art for Pentagram City compared to the show proper, it looks like it stayed pretty consistent.
Looking at how it appears in Stayed Gone, we can see that Vee Tower, the Hazbin Hotel, Rosie's Emporium, and the Heaven Embassy are all in the same places as they were in the concept art. It would be pretty safe to assume, therefore, that Uptown, Downtown, the Entertainment District, and Cannibal Town are all the same, too.
While there isn't anything concrete here to place the Industrial or Doomsday Districts, we do also get a rough Pentagram City map in Finale:
We can tell that this is also pentagram city because of the point connected to the Vees, Alastor, and Rosie (I'm pretty sure that's her arm at the bottom) all align with the already established placements of Vee Tower, the Hotel, and Rosie's Emporium. (The camera pans up right after this so we can see that the other two lines connected to the same point as Alastor connect to Charlie and Lucifer, which makes that point the Hotel).
Because of that, we know that the Industrial District stayed the same, with the point connected to Carmilla's photo matching its placement in the concept art. Interestingly, there isn't a line connecting Rosie's photo to her point, nor does Zestial get connected to a point, though he is clearly being lumped in with Carmilla. I also find it fascinating that Zeezi's photo is here, as I wouldn't have assumed that she's a particularly important Overlord; her domain seems to be pretty niche. I think it's also fair to assume that the Doomsday district is exactly where it was in the concept art, as well.
The reason I went down this rabbit hole at all was because I was curious to see if I could figure out where Magic Kat was in Pentagram City, or at least a reasonable guess.
Based on the purples and blues on the buildings around it, and the specifics of the signs, I think I'd place it somewhere in the Entertainment District. It would be fitting for a casino, though I think it'd be tucked off in a corner somewhere, as far from the Vees as Husk could manage (we know he doesn't think very highly of them, and by the time he became and Overlord, Vox would've already been in power for a couple decades, and Val might have already been established as well).

proportions:
the first tip i can recommend for proportion checking is zooming out of your canvas. the main reason why something can feel off is because of staying too zoomed into one part of a drawing.
(this is a bit ambiguous so im going to say drawing a pose for example) i usually try and sketch the idea i have in my head the best i can and if something feels off or doesn’t quite capture what i was trying to imagine—the first automatic thing i do is zoom out and mirror the canvas to determine a probable cause for what is making it look a certain way.
the second tip i can recommend for overall structure is using a reference (or if you wanna get nitty gritty) a posing app like magic poser. posing apps/websites have been a lifesaver especially when there isn’t a photo for a specific pose i have in mind. moving all the limbs on your own can be time consuming but it definitely helps.
rendering:
everyone’s taste in rendering is subjective, but helpful advice i can offer you is to study the individual (s) you look up to frequently. when i first started studying an artist i admire, i would observe and ask myself questions on the purpose of why they would place some kind of detail somewhere. i would also ask what it is i liked about said person’s rendering and try to find a way to apply it to my own art (without completely plagiarizing it). if there is something you like about an artist’s rendering style but can figure out what it is exactly, it might be helpful to think about; brush texture, stylization, expression, emotion, mood, color palette, or tone.
i think the key takeaway is not how many tips you obtain but how consistent you are with them. time will definitely be your friend if you manage to stay consistent in your efforts :)
